Transaction 341e333309705add85c96ab8381fc59ba0a92f75519a7d7a92436c62b136cf9a

1 Input
2 Outputs
  • 341e333309705add85c96ab8381fc59ba0a92f75519a7d7a92436c62b136cf9a:0
  • value  1206010
    address  199WuHo116e7qTwdcFretzeiyaVnRtoqAb
  • 341e333309705add85c96ab8381fc59ba0a92f75519a7d7a92436c62b136cf9a:1
  • value  1392400
    address  1JyEp1NBY7JjQbrkBcnUjPw29CfYDC9PG2